Al-Hakim Mosque

From Wacklepedia - The Free Encyclopedia


Al-Hakim Mosque is one of the largest Fatimid mosques in Cairo. Construction of it commenced in 990 under Caliph Abu Mansoor Nizar al-Aziz, but was completed it under his son Caliph al-Hakim bi Amr Allah in 1013.
